Abstract
We introduce a new algorithm for fitting a subdivision surface to a given shape within a prescribed tolerance. In an interactive environment the smooth mesh points can be migrated to the implicit surface, in idle moments when the user is not interacting with the model. To solve the mesh optimization problem that captures the competing desires of tight geometric fit and compact representation. We demonstrate that displaced subdivision surfaces offer a number of benefits, including geometry compression, editing, animation, scalability, and adaptive rendering.
